The door lock wires for the Viper alarm are green (-)lock and blue (-) unlock. The Viper system only provides a negative lock/unlock pulse for the door locks. So, if you are working on a vehicle that has positive door locks you will have to install relays to change the polarity.

I have DRL on my car and with the factory alarm remote when you press either the lock or unlock the head lights or the parking lights come on. With my Viper 2 way remote no lights come on when pressin

The Viper alarm (and most other alarms) are designed to be connected to the parking lights.The headlights are not meant to be flashed continuously, as when the alarm is triggered. If you want the headlights to activate with the alarm then, the parking light wire from the Viper needs to be connected to the headlight wire instead. NOT RECOMMENDED.
Although the Viper alarm may or may not have a horn output (you didn't mention the model) ,it can be connected and it can be programmed to sound either when the alarm is triggered or all the time(depending on the model).
By the way, the Driving while Running Lights are seperate from the Sentry Illumination Lights. The Sentry Illumination Lights are designed to illuminate the area in front and around of the vehicle before and after entry. They can be programmed for the time that they will illuminated before and after entry.

2011 nissan sentra s door lock actuator wiring diagram

From the plug in door lock harness of the Viper alarm (green and blue): the green lock wire goes to the red wire of the vehicle in the driver kick panel and the blue wire goes to the pink wire in the kick panel. The light green with black wire from the Viper alarm goes to the white wire in the drivers kick panel. This white wire is the factory alarm disarm wire. It tests with the key in the door cylinder. Turn the key to unlock the door and the wire should register ground.
